Epidural Blood Patch

 

Questions & Answers

1) The CSF pressure in patients with a PDPHA tends to be _____
a) high
b) low
c) unpredictable

2) The injection of fluid in the epidural space causes CSF pressure to _____
a) rise for short time
b) rise for 24 hours
c) there is no effect
d) fall slightly

3) The time for clot formation is _____ when blood comes into contact with CSF.
a) prolonged
b) shortened
c) unchanged

4) When blood is injected into the epidural space when a dural leak is present it tends to _____
a) be washed away from the dura by the escaping CSF
b) distribute symetrically above and below the hole
c) adhere to the dura
d) mix with the CSF and not form a clot

5) The presence of septae in the epidural space always makes a blood patch successful because it prevents the blood from spreading to far.
T or F

ANSWERS : 1. B, 2. A, 3. B, 4. C, 5. F
